Just wondering if it's better to keep sonar logs in chunks rather than single file.

To clarify: better to set the EliteTi so that it stops each recording at a certain file size (if so which is best suggested 100MB/200MB...)?

Overlapping log paths are bad or good?

I think it is much better to keep your sonar log files relatively short - perhaps 100-200MB or so. A few reasons for this: Files occasionally do get corrupted when recording (rarely, but it happens), so multiple, shorter files helps protect against losing data this way. Smaller files are better handled in ReefMaster, since data for the entire file needs to be loaded for sidescan viewing. It uses less memory, and is quicker, to load and view smaller files. Files can still be combined as required to create mosaics.
